What are the most common Nissan repairs needed by drivers in the Bristolville area?

Given the rural roads and variable weather in Trumbull County, common repairs include CV axle and suspension component wear from potholes, along with brake system service due to stop-and-go driving on routes like SR 88. For Nissans, specifically, issues like CVT transmission service on models like the Rogue or Altima are also frequent.

When should I seek service for my Nissan's CVT transmission around Bristolville?

Seek service immediately if you notice hesitation, jerking, or whining noises, as these are common CVT warning signs. Given the hilly terrain in parts of Northeast Ohio, adhering strictly to Nissan's recommended fluid change intervals (often around 60,000 miles) is crucial to prevent costly transmission failure.

What local factors in Bristolville should influence my Nissan's maintenance schedule?

The cold, snowy winters require diligent attention to your battery, tire tread, and the corrosion protection of your undercarriage from road salt. Furthermore, frequent travel on gravel or uneven rural roads near Bristolville means you should have your alignment, shocks, and tire pressure checked more often than the standard schedule suggests.
